A taxation system that works

UK lawmakers have long tinkered with taxation systems for the gambling market, trying to find the best solution. The decision to tax operators differently was criticized at first but proved its worth in the long run. Today, they pay different percentages based on the services provided, but everyone is subject to taxation. Bingo websites and online casinos that provide gaming services online are subject to the highest taxes of 15%. By comparison, lotteries are only charged 12%, which is a huge difference.

Offshore companies are not outside the reach of the UK GC and they are also subject to other taxes. Fixed odds and betting exchanges are charged 15%, with the lowest taxes applying to financial spread bets. These are subject to a 3% tax, which is significantly lower than the standard 10% duty on all other types of spread bets. The entire system is coordinated through The Remote Gaming Duty and the Pool Betting Duty which makes it easy for operators to estimate their taxes.

Billions in British pounds generated by gambling

The government frequently criticizes the gambling industry for being too ruthless and praying on vulnerable players. The UK GC has proposed new regulations that protect problem gamblers from the risks of addiction. On the other hand, the industry continues to generate a lot of profit, not only for the casinos but also for state coffers. The numbers from 2017 highlight the fact that the budget got a massive £2.7bn from taxes paid by bookmakers, casinos and poker rooms.

A quick glance at the taxes paid by casinos indicates the fact that more money is being collected every year. The differences are not considerable, but the trend is clearly positive and this is what matters the most. A significant source of revenue is the taxation of remote gambling, which is now the preferred form of gaming for most new players. The money is spent by the government to fund education and infrastructure projects, so the taxes paid by gambling operators are put to good use.
